The only restriction on using the old memory card is possible encryption of the media. doing a device switch is supposed to move all the data. If its not encrypted then your all set.
If you run into issues reusing the micro card it may be easier to just buy a new one.
You can also plug the old BB into the PC and connect to it as a drive and move data to your PC .
